/
.travis.yml
56 lines (43 loc) · 1.61 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
language: scala
sudo: required
dist: trusty
scala:
- 2.10.6
- 2.11.8
env:
global:
- GH_REF: github.com/outworkers/phantom.git
- secure: WwLG0fkVV1DS5P6GeLOHjPJ2z+GP9UaLzX27DuHBEXRxNPPw27y7jag0gbbf6E80kYwGB4zfBx9YjcJFVFdGCCcAjDJHMP8kLQirUak1jzuoWZFUEtTkF7ev/OVs0PmMHrOGuysT4W/UaL9MZD/mYO5lO9oavycTQ0kbOwZJwUg=
- secure: Qtr5ULJ90s5pfLBaXRKFLMPBcDSYBQfUVz+abgjlG/um8iWE/OJswYn2n3zylAqnI4bSKhPobl6bBYzt8f6k9kzMqpR4t/4gWFV1LJUas0eAsTnrjV1He4nbPvO9RVEkvuQcTCqmus2AgYEnwdKhGWwktok5PAoJ22ycy4HK8C8=
- secure: hbuc+lReAC/tzOfmF3M70L4Qfb48S6fI/gqchctnBD7TcZ6i13EOLhsjgPkFwTuINYU7Bvwd54yjy9simu1Se34+DaGtxKPJ8NZIeWk0ciCGyFxNiz0QVkE+/Cc0kZLD7hJXb0UpLsbMwpIQFlL6FHcB/2xGmMhgYvGHe7+64zM=
- secure: ma0SLHvjzABno6RmwR/LSZQVC6rv6UcUt5kJAz1l4yJmASpdxkivoa8xWXahsjYP1O05IWuPFGHy/o0Vu7fxykgqN5gOg01wVQ0irjguWR04nNLUQTrOUgKPXR3w22USAbPpzxxqQrGc0ZS/2QFpiu9fvLNsBTkZcosA3oLpyiY=
- secure: hihHuKLYf8YemlopCITLM1QvvgJH7ITTTsLRvLxKOGfzzBsOLd1m6LKpDOrmWdoKtcigyON+J3AP24DBd4zO95Y8r+Cwq8I4IVfZol3qwhJxvYMSB4Tyje3ssSUGqr/LBUBdLAe8H5pBeoeAECt/iSjDcYYRLKVexWRaJJBafXY=
notifications:
slack:
- websudos:P9QNXx1ZGFnDHp3v3jUqtB8k
email:
- dev@websudos.co.uk
branches:
only:
- master
- develop
- feature/2.0.0
jdk:
- oraclejdk7
- oraclejdk8
matrix:
include:
- scala: 2.12.0
jdk: oraclejdk8
addons:
apt:
packages:
- oracle-java8-installer
before_install: unset SBT_OPTS JVM_OPTS
before_script: travis_retry sbt "plz $TRAVIS_SCALA_VERSION update"
install:
- pip install 'requests[security]'
- pip install ccm
- ccm create test -v 2.2.8 -n 3 -s
script: ./build/run_tests.sh
after_success: ./build/publish_develop.sh